How they compare

Madagascar currently reports 1.63 kt against 0 kt in Syrian Arab Republic, a difference of 1.63 kt.

Across all 36 years both countries report, Madagascar has been ahead every year.

Madagascar ranks 14th and Syrian Arab Republic ranks 16th of 115 countries.

Madagascar has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
